Meanings of deferments

  • noun
    1. An act or instance of deferring or putting off.
    2. Officially sanctioned postponement of compulsory military service.

Example Sentences

  • The university offers deferments for students facing personal or financial hardships.
  • Multiple deferments on the loan only delayed the inevitable payments.
  • Soldiers could apply for deferments based on family or educational circumstances.
  • During the pandemic, many companies granted deferments on rent and utilities.
  • His history of loan deferments raised concerns during the credit review.
